This dialogue between a confederate apologist and a unionist occurred on-line. I have recreated the dialogue using images of public figures to differentiate the speakers, and do not imply these statements were in fact made by those public individuals.

Note: Ron Paul was selected for the unreconstructed confederate views he expressed in his primary appearance on Meet The Press in 2008, including his views on civil rights and the 14th Amendment.
Originally, this dialogue occurred in a context, which I will not explain here, that justified my at times aggressive and patronizing tone.

This video will be multiple parts of which this is the first.

My original statement to which the confederate apologist responded was:

"There is one apology that I think is long over due: the Democratic Party should apologize for its defense of slavery, causing the Civil War, and installing Jim Crow laws....just for starters."
